
The Ajman Police have started rolling out a new Dh35-million security project to provide seamless services to people, ensure safety of the residents and achieve the National Agenda 2021.
Major General Shaikh Sultan bin Abdullah Al Nuaimi, Commander-in-Chief of Ajman Police, said that the project includes construction of a new center for traffic and patrols department in Al Jarf area, the Al Jarf Police Center, establishment of a civil defence center in Masfoot, and setting up of a new building for the Ajman Police headquarters on Sheikh Mohammed bin Rashid Street.
As part of this year's plan, the police are also working to establish two new centers for social support, to strengthen the relationship between the police and community members and contribute to solving societal issues.
These are expected to be completed within this year to provide best services for residents and citizens of the emirate.
